Freescale Semiconductor, Inc.

Freescale Semiconductor, Inc.

User Guide

Application Hardware and Software Configuration

Table 6-1. Required Software Configuration

for Dedicated Hardware Platform

Hardware

Dedicated

Required Software

Platform

Customizing File

Configuration

 

 

 

Low-voltage evaluation

const_cust_evmm.

#include const_cust_evmm.h

motor hardware

h

into code.fun.c

 

 

 

Low-voltage hardware

const_cust_lv.h

#include const_cust_lv.h

into code.fun.c

 

 

 

 

 

...\bldc_zerocros08MR32\sources\code_fun.c, program C language functions

...\bldc_zerocros08MR32\sources\code_fun.h, program C language functions header

...\bldc_zerocros08MR32\sources\const.h, main program definitions

...\bldc_zerocros08MR32\sources\mr32io.h, MC68HC908MR32 registers definitions file

...\bldc_zerocros08MR32\sources\mr32_bit.h, MCHC908MR32 register bits definitions file

...\bldc_zerocros08MR32\sources\bldc08.c, main program

...\bldc_zerocros08MR32\sources\code_start.c, motor alignment and starting (back-EMF acquisition) state functions

...\bldc_zerocros08MR32\sources\code_start.h, motor alignment and starting (back-EMF acquisition) state function header

...\bldc_zerocros08MR32\sources\code_run.c, motor running state function

...\bldc_zerocros08MR32\sources\code_run.h, motor running state function header

...\bldc_zerocros08MR32\sources\code_isr.c, program interrupt functions

...\bldc_zerocros08MR32\sources\code_isr.h, program interrupt functions header

DRM028 — Rev 0

 

Designer Reference Manual

 

 

 

MOTOROLA

User Guide

119

 

For More Information On This Product,

 

 

Go to: www.freescale.com

 

Page 119
Image 119
Motorola M68HC08 manual bldczerocros08MR32\sources\bldc08.c, main program